    I'm delighted with the quality, comfort and fit of my Sargent seat. Got mine from Sandhills Powersports for $316 including shipping.

    Went the Convertibars route for maximum adjustability. I'm delighted with the Convertibars, too, but they're expensive as you need longer brake, clutch and throttle lines to get to the maximum rise and pullback. About $540 and at least four hours labor to install.

    Whether you do Helibars or Convertibars, you may find that double bubble isn't tall enough after you change the bars. I'm very pleased with the Zero Gravity Sport Touring screen. About 3 or 4 inches taller than stock with a little kick-up at the top.
